综合合分类和相关反馈技术的图像语义检索研究

来源 :广西大学 | 被引量 : 0次 | 上传用户:bigwbiso
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
图像的高层语义与低层特征之间存在着巨大的“语义鸿沟”,这是图像检索发展过程中一个无法回避的问题。随着研究的深入,人们发现基于内容的图像检索(Content-BasedImageRetrieval,CBIR)技术由于“语义鸿沟”的存在已经开始不能满足用户的检索需要,因为人们更习惯于根据图像的语义而不是颜色、纹理等低层特征来进行检索。而基于文本的图像检索(Text-BasedImageRetrieval,TBIR)虽能以文本方式对图像的语义进行人工标注,但其存在着工作量大及人工标注具有主观性等局限性。所以,进行面向语义的图像检索(Semantic-BasedImageRetrieval,SBIR)技术的研究具有重要的理论价值和应用前景。   目前,SBIR技术的研究主要可以分为以下四大类:基于分类和聚类的SBIR.、基于相关反馈的SBIR、基于关联图像和语义建模的SBIR以及针对特殊领域的SBIR。而本文主要从分类和相关反馈两个方向,利用支持向量机和模糊理论对SBIR进行了研究。本文的主要研究工作可归纳为以下几点:   (1)在深入研究分类技术和模糊支持向量机(FuzzySupportVectorMachine,FSVM)的基础上,针对图像语义的模糊性和传统支持向量机(SupportVectorMachine,SVM)在搭建多类分类器时产生的不可分区域,提出一种用FSVM实现的基于分类的SBIR(SBIR-Classification-FSVM,SBIR-C-FSVM)算法,并给出其对应的检索模型。实验结果表明,本文提出的SBIR-C-FSVM算法的检索性能与基于SVM的图像检索算法及综合多特征的CBIR算法相比均有了显著的改进,其平均查全率分别提高了9.26%和57.99%,平均查准率则分别提高了8.84%和59.79%   (2)在深入研究了基于相关反馈的SBIR技术的基础上,针对利用相关反馈实现图像语义检索时所存在的小样本、样本不均衡、忽略大量未标记样本及历史反馈信息等问题,综合相关反馈中的短期学习和长期学习技术,提出一个用FSVM实现的基于相关反馈的SBIR(SBIR-RelevanceFeedback-FSVM,SBIR-RF-FSVM)算法,并给出其对应的检索模型。实验结果表明,本文提出的SBIR-RF-FSVM算法的检索性能与用SVM实现的综合短期学习和长期学习的SBIR算法及用FSVM实现的基于短期学习的SBIR.算法相比均有了明显改进,其平均查全率分别提高了2.3%和3.1%,平均查准率则分别提高了11.3%和15.6%。   (3)针对基于相关反馈的SBIR技术中的实时性要求,将之前提到的SBIR-C-FSVM模型和SBIR-RF-FSVM模型相结合,开发了一个用FSVM实现的综合分类技术和相关反馈技术的SBIR系统。该系统平均查全率比SBIR-C-FSVM系统和SBIR-RF-FSVM系统分别提高了3%和5%,平均查准率则分别提高了14.7%和23.6%。
其他文献
随着互联网的迅猛发展,网络上的文本信息呈指数级的增长。网络信息的高流动性使得这些文本中存在大量重复的信息。这些重复文本会给信息检索工具带来巨大的挑战,所以如何快速
随着计算机软件技术的快速发展,软件产品已经应用到社会的各个领域,现今的软件已经逐步成为构件组装的集合体,这样,每个构件的质量的好坏将直接影响到软件的整体质量。所以,
流水作业调度问题是一类具有广泛应用的组合优化问题。总完工时间、总误工时间、最大完工时间和总加权误工时间是几个重要的性能指标。论文对最小化总完工时间的流水作业调度
近年来,软件网络化、服务化的趋势使得软件的交付模式、应用模式、产品形态和商业模式都产生了巨大变化,软件已经成为一种服务(Software as a service,SaaS),即人们以“使用
随着计算机互联网的蓬勃发展,网络攻击频繁发生,如蠕虫病毒、分布式拒绝服务攻击(DDoS)、端口扫描等。这些攻击事件在短时间内产生大量的网络链接,导致网络堵塞甚至瘫痪。如
序列模型就是结构化模型中的一个经典模型,在自然语言处理、计算机视觉、生物信息学等领域得到了广泛的应用。对其模型及算法的研究和改进,具有重大的意义和实用价值。在过去
基于视觉的智能导航系统是机器视觉领域中的研究热点之一。道路识别算法作为智能导航系统的重要组成部分,采用图像处理、机器学习与模式识别等技术检测道路路面,为智能导航系
学位
随着经济全球化和市场国际化,使得企业间的竞争日趋激烈,企业的生产过程也越来越复杂,企业要保持核心竞争力,就必须要使其各个业务流程紧密联系,协同配合。计算机支持的协同
体系结构的发展使得大规模集群已经发展到多核的时代,多核架构对并行计算提出了新的要求。通信在并行计算中扮演着重要的作用,提升多核架构下通信的效率对提升并行计算的效率